Advances in Study on Polyamines During Flowering and Fruit Setting and Development in Higher Plants

Abstract: Polyamines are physiologically active materials with broad functions of regulation, and have a close relationship with the growth and development of higher plants. This paper reviews the relationship between endogenous polyamines and floral bud induction and sex differentiation, flowering, fruit setting and fruit development in higher plants. Effects of exogenous polyamines on flowering a n d fruit setting and development are also reviewed. Both the modes of action and potential applications of polyamines on higher plant in flowering and fruit setting and development are discussed.
